&lt;p&gt;I do not believe similar tests or a comparison with the nRF52840 has been performed, not by us anyway. I would expect the dongle to perform slightly worse as we have seen earlier that similar dongle designs have lower gain compared with similar DK designs. Still, this is very environment dependant, there might be some environments where both reach 3200m or any given distance, and there might be some environments in which only one or none of them do. Based on our latest tests 3200m might seem a little ambitious, but again it might be possible for some environments.&lt;/p&gt;
